A member asked:

What is a good med for trilgelmial neuralgia . i've already been on trileptal it deleped my sodium. i'm on gabintin and dilantin now it's not working?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Suggest: If it is meds, might find more success with lyrica, (pregabalin) baclofen, or even amitryptyline, but there are minimally invasive surgical techniques via needle/balloon decompressions of the foramens where the nerve exits. Maybe consult a neurosurgeon.
